Our Mediation Approach

Sonya represents both employees and employers, which puts her in the unique position of being able to understand the needs and interests of each party:

  • Employees have bills to pay, families to feed and care for, and possibly new jobs to attend to, and litigation takes time and emotional energy away from these important matters.
  • Employers have businesses to run, company morale to worry about, and employees who need to focus on their jobs rather than on depositions, document searches, and witness interviews.

Our approach to mediation is also highlighted by the following:

  • Sonya understands that a successful resolution may not only depend on the employee and employer coming to an agreement; spouses or significant others on the employee side, and board members, shareholders, partners, or other members on the employer side, may impact a settlement.
  • Sonya uses her empathy, compassion, and great listening skills to gain the parties’ and counsel’s trust.
  • Sonya understands that each case comes with a unique set of challenges, and a one-size-fits-all approach often won’t get it done. Trained in a variety of mediation techniques and processes, Sonya tailors her approach to the specific needs of each matter.
  • As someone who understands the nuances of employment law, Sonya will provide an unbiased, straightforward view to guide the parties toward a settlement.
  • Sonya has worked with insurance carriers as an attorney and mediator and understands the interplay between the carrier and employer in resolving a case.
